Wanda Koop's "Satellite Cities" is an enigmatic vision rendered in oil on canvas. The industrial materials, paint, and canvas, serve as the foundation of the artwork, and speak to the artist's engagement with urban landscapes and their social context. The painting's hazy atmosphere, with its pale blues, greens, and yellows, reflects the artist’s mastery of the medium. Koop expertly manipulates oil paint to create a sense of depth and distance. The cityscapes appear dreamlike and ethereal, as though emerging from a distant memory, or a premonition of a city yet to come. The effect encourages a sense of quiet contemplation about the impact of urban development on the environment and our collective future. Koop's approach challenges traditional notions of landscape painting, as it transcends mere representation. In doing so, she elevates the medium of paint and canvas to convey deeper meanings and narratives about contemporary life.
